**Former Chief Minister Hemant Soren faces setback in Jharkhand High Court**
Former Chief Minister Hemant Soren has received a setback from the Jharkhand High Court. The court dismissed the petition challenging Soren’s arrest and also rejected the interim bail plea. The decision was kept on hold by the High Court executive justice and judge Navneet Kumar’s bench after the completion of the hearing on 28th February.
**Some relief for Hemant Soren from the court**
While Hemant Soren was denied bail, he was granted permission to attend his uncle’s funeral ceremony on 6th May. However, he was instructed to stay away from the media during this period. The Supreme Court will hear a petition filed by Hemant Soren on 6th May, as there was a delay in the decision-making process in the High Court.
**Setback for Hemant Soren in the Special PMEL Court in Ranchi**
Earlier, on 27th April, Hemant Soren faced a setback in the Special PMEL Court in Ranchi. He was denied interim bail in a land scam case. Hemant Soren had requested a 13-day interim bail to attend his uncle’s last rites. However, the court rejected the bail plea during the hearing.
**Investigation related to 8.86 acres of land in Ranchi**
The investigation against Hemant Soren in Ranchi is related to 8.86 acres of land. The Enforcement Directorate has accused him of illegally occupying the land. The agency has filed charges against Soren, Prasad, and Soren’s alleged frontman Raj Kumar Pahan, along with others, in a Special PMEL Court in Ranchi on 30th March.
